Valparaiso holds off Green Bay for 1st place in Horizon

VALPARAISO, Ind. (AP) Tevonn Walker scored 20 points as Valparaiso beat Green Bay 63-59 Friday night in a battle for first place in the Horizon League.

Daeshon Francis and Carrington Love hit back-to-back 3-pointers to pull Green Bay within 56-49 with 2:34 left. Then Love's 3-pointer with 35 seconds remaining cut Green Bay's deficit to two points. But Valparaiso made 5 of 6 free throws in the final minute to seal it.

Alec Peters added 12 points and grabbed 10 rebounds for Valparaiso (23-4, 10-2 Horizon).

Valparaiso went on an 8-0 run, all scored by Peters, to take a 15-point lead midway through the second half.

Valparaiso held a 29-23 lead at halftime after shooting 50 percent from the field. The Crusaders held a 20-7 advantage on the glass but turned it over 14 times in the opening 20 minutes.

Love led Green Bay (20-6, 9-3) with 15 points. Jordan Fouse had 11, and Alfonzo McKinnie and Greg Mays added 10 apiece.
